单词 muscle spindle
释义

muscle spindlen.

Brit. /ˈmʌsl ˌspɪndl/, U.S. /ˈməs(ə)l ˌspɪnd(ə)l/
Origin: Formed within English, by compounding; modelled on a German lexical item. Etymons: muscle n., spindle n.
Etymology: < muscle n. + spindle n., after German Muskelspindel (W. Kühne 1863, in Arch. f. Pathol. Anat. u. Physiol. 27 528).
Anatomy and Physiology.
A fusiform bundle of specialized muscle fibres with sensory and motor innervation enclosed in a capsule of connective tissue, present in large numbers in skeletal muscle and sensitive especially to stretch.

1894 Jrnl. Physiol. 17 238 He [sc. Kühne] designated the bundles simply in virtue of their shape, muscle-spindles, ‘muskel-spindeln’, the name adopted here as the most suitable of all that have been applied.
1930 A. A. Maximow & W. Bloom Text-bk. Histol. xiv. 276 Not infrequently, of two branches of the same sensory fiber one supplies a muscle spindle, the other a tendon spindle.
1974 R. A. Bergman & A. K. Afifi Atlas Microsc. Anat. vi. 140 Muscle spindles are found within skeletal muscles. Each spindle is formed of two to ten small muscle fibers, the intrafusal fibers, enclosed within a sheath of connective tissue.
1986 Times 24 July 22 Muscle spindles, the sense organs which record muscular tensions and so provide the ‘feed-back’ necessary for smooth movement.
